Description
Technical field
The invention belongs to vanadium field of chemical metallurgical technology, and in particular to a kind of production method of clean vanadium liquid.
Background technology
Vanadic anhydride production conventional method be vanadium slag sodium roasting-vanadium liquid purification-ammonium salt precipitation method, wherein 65% with
On vanadium product come from the method.So-called vanadium liquid purification, exactly removing influences the impurity element of precipitation effect in vanadium liquid, influence
The principal element of vanadium liquid precipitation effect has impurity element(Silicon, phosphorus, iron, aluminium)And suspension in stoste.According to raw material vanadium slag feature,
Vanadium liquid impurity situation Si contents are between 600mg/L to 800mg/L, and P content is between 80mg/L to 100mg/L.
At present, removal of impurities is carried out in 25g/L~30g/L vanadium solutions to vanadium concentration, using traditional vanadium liquid impurity removal process:It is a kind of
It is regulation vanadium liquid pH, silicon, the phosphorus added into vanadium liquid in aluminum sulfate solution, co-precipitation liquid phase;Another is the pH for controlling vanadium liquid,
Calcium or magnesia additives are added into vanadium liquid, silicon, phosphorus in liquid phase is removed.Qualified solution impurity after domestic vanadium industry removal of impurities contains
Measure and be:Silicon is less than 500mg/L, and phosphorus content is less than 15mg/L.
The ammonium salt precipitation method have two kinds:A kind of is that the pH value of the solution containing pentavalent vanadium first is adjusted into 8.5~9.5, then by molten
V in liquid2O5With the mass ratio 1 of ammonium salt:1.3~1.5 add ammonium salt Precipitation ammonium metavanadate;Another reconciled using substep
The pH value of solution adds ammonium salt Precipitation ammonium poly-vanadate to 1.5~2.5, after obtained ammonium metavanadate or ammonium poly-vanadate are passed through
Calcining obtains vanadic anhydride.Because the impurity that precipitation process is carried secretly does not have suitable method to be gone in follow-up process
Remove, so the vanadic anhydride impurity content obtained using process above is higher, the grade of vanadic anhydride only has 98% left side
The right side, containing impurity elements such as Fe, Al, K, Na, Ca, Mg, Si, P, S and As, it is difficult to meet multiple fields to purity of vanadium pentoxide
Requirement.
As can be seen here, using the method for purification is precipitated, it is necessary to add the cleanser of a large amount of calcics, magnesium, aluminium or sodium plasma, produce
Cost is higher and easily causes that the element single index of these in product is exceeded, so the vanadium product purity that production is obtained is not high,
98.5% or so.
The content of the invention
The technical problem to be solved in the present invention is the purification process of simplified vanadium liquid, reduces the use of additives, reduction purification
Cost, improves vanadium production efficiency, realizes the clean manufacturing of clean vanadium liquid.
In order to solve the above technical problems, the present invention takes following technical proposals:
A kind of production method of clean vanadium liquid, vanadium slag carries out NH after saltless roasting4 +Leach, amount of water is vanadium slag quality
1 ~ 4 times, leaching process NH4 +Concentration is 1 ~ 50g/L, and filtering obtains low impurity content ammonium leaching vanadium liquid, i.e., clean vanadium liquid.
Vanadium slag saltless roasting temperature of the present invention is 850 ~ 1050 DEG C, and roasting time is 1-5h, and clinker extraction temperature is 0
~ 50 DEG C, roasting process is without additives.
Leaching pH value of the present invention is 7 ~ 11.
Control ph method of the present invention is that CO is supplemented into solution2, for pressurization tonifying Qi, moulding pressure be 0.1 ~
1MPa。
NH of the present invention4 +Concentration control method is that NH is supplemented into solution3, for pressurization tonifying Qi, moulding pressure be 0.1 ~
1MPa。
The content range of impurity element is as follows in clean vanadium liquid of the present invention:Al<1.0ppm, As<1.0ppm, Ca<
20.0 ppm;Cr<8.0ppm, Fe<10.0ppm, Mg<20.0ppm;Mn<5.0ppm;K<50.0ppm, Na<1000.0 ppm, P<
50.0, Si<50.0ppm;S<100.0ppm.
Obtained purification vanadium liquid of the present invention is suitable for producing high purity vanadium.
Vanadium slag of the present invention meets《Vanadium slag GB5062-85》In regulation.
It is using the beneficial effect produced by above-mentioned technical proposal:The present invention uses Sources controlling leachate impurity content
Technique, simplify follow-up impurity removal process step, reduce reagent consumption, production cost is low, process cleans, be conducive to industrial life
Production.
Embodiment
With embodiment, the present invention is further detailed explanation below.
Embodiment 1
A kind of production method of clean vanadium liquid described herein is carried out according to following technique:
Vanadium slag carries out saltless roasting 1h under the conditions of 1050 DEG C, obtains after roasting clinker, carries out NH4 +Leach, extraction temperature
For 10 DEG C, amount of water is 2 times of vanadium slag quality, and leaching process supplements NH by the 0.1MPa that pressurizes3, adjust NH4 +Concentration is 30g/
L;To solution pressurization 0.1MPa supplements CO2, it is 10 that pH value is leached in adjustment, after stirring, filtering, obtains the leaching of low impurity content ammonium
Vanadium liquid, i.e., clean vanadium liquid, obtained purification vanadium liquid is suitable for producing high purity vanadium.
